About the role

  • Plan and execute regional dinners, partner lunches, conferences, speaking events, and on-site activations
  • Own logistics end-to-end: venue sourcing, reservations/contracts, menus, AV, staffing, run-of-show, and day-of coordination
  • Build event briefs for the field team (objectives, attendee list, talk tracks, materials checklist, follow-up plan)
  • Manage invitation workflows, RSVP tracking, headcounts, and attendee communications
  • Ensure all confirmations are locked 24–48 hours prior
  • Manage conference booth needs: booth ordering, vendor deadlines, shipping/drayage coordination, setup requirements, and onsite readiness
  • Create repeatable playbooks and checklists for each event type to eliminate last-minute scramble
  • Coordinate signage, collateral, table materials, and display assets; ensure on-brand execution
  • Create branded virtual invitations and digital event materials to support webinars, CE programs, and regional activations
  • Own swag ordering and production across apparel and promotional items
  • Maintain inventory counts, storage, packing, and shipping to reps and events
  • Build standardized “field kits” and maintain an approved asset library
  • Produce post-event recaps: attendance, leads captured, meetings booked, learnings, and recommendations

Requirements

  • BA/BS degree or equivalent practical experience
  • 2–5+ years of experience in relevant areas such as field marketing, event operations, marketing operations, sales enablement, executive/event coordination, or commercial operations
  • Demonstrated ability to manage logistics-heavy programs end-to-end
  • Proficiency with common business tools (Google Workspace, Excel/Sheets, PowerPoint/Slides) and project tracking tools
  • Comfortable working cross-functionally with Marketing, BD/Sales, Operations, and external partners
  • Experience in healthcare, mental health, or referral-driven growth environments
  • Familiarity with CRM basics (Salesforce) for lead routing and follow-up tracking
  • Light creative production literacy (print specs, proofing, vendor file requirements)
